In January 2022 the Supreme Court set up an inquiry committee, headed by former Supreme Court judge Justice Indu Malhotra, to examine the security lapse during the Prime Minister's visit to Ferozepur, Punjab, when his convoy was stranded on a flyover for about twenty minutes. She had recently retired from the Supreme Court and was named to lead the panel.

When a matter of national importance needs an independent probe, the Supreme Court can constitute an inquiry committee, often led by a retired judge, in preference to a purely government-run inquiry. The January 2022 security breach during the Prime Minister's Punjab visit was referred to such a court-appointed committee headed by Justice Indu Malhotra.

- The committee was constituted by the Supreme Court in January 2022.
- It was headed by former Supreme Court judge Justice Indu Malhotra.
- It examined the security lapse during the Prime Minister's visit to Ferozepur, Punjab, where the convoy was stuck on a flyover.
- Justice Indu Malhotra had earlier been the first woman lawyer elevated directly from the Bar to the Supreme Court.
